Transport for Wales

About
Transport for Wales is a public transport provider in Wales, UK. It operates a comprehensive network of trains, buses and ferries across the country. The trains are modern and comfortable, with a range of different types including InterCity Express Trains, Regional Trains, and Metro Trains.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. There are a variety of ticket types available, including single and return tickets, season tickets, and group tickets. The most popular routes include Cardiff to Swansea, Cardiff to Newport, and Cardiff to Manchester.

Merseyrail

About
Mersey Rail is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ates a network of commuter and regional services in the North West of England. Mersey Rail operates a variety of train types, including the Class 507 and Class 508 electric multiple units, and the Class 142 and Class 150 diesel multiple units. It also operates the Merseyrail Electrics, a fleet of electric multiple units. Mersey Rail offers a range of ticket types, including single, return, and season tickets. Onboard facilities include Wi-Fi, power sockets, and air conditioning. The most popular routes for Mersey Rail are Liverpool to Southport, Liverpool to Chester, and Liverpool to Ormskirk.
